YEAR-ROUND PROGRAMMING
Free programs running every week.
In addition to seasonal events, NHSQ offers free recurring programs throughout the year. Open to all Queens residents — no income, immigration, or background restrictions.

Ongoing 9-Week Cohorts
Icing on the Cake
Culinary Entrepreneurship. Baking, business planning, licensing, and financial management for immigrant and working-class residents launching small food businesses. Cohorts run in English and Spanish at 94-33 Corona Avenue.

Quarterly · In-Person
Know Your Rights Workshops
Tenant rights, affordable housing, eviction prevention, estate planning, and housing court navigation. Especially valuable for renters in Queens' most rent-burdened neighborhoods.

Year-Round · In-Person
Energy Efficiency Workshops
NYSERDA-supported energy audits, LED kit distribution, and electrification readiness counseling to reduce utility burden for Queens homeowners and renters.

Ongoing Cohorts · EN/ES
Digital Literacy Cohorts
Hands-on digital skills training designed for immigrants and residents without prior digital experience. Every graduate takes home a computer.
